Subject: Work around silly (unused) atomic problem
|
|
|
|
Exclude static inline functions with atomics from C++ compilation.
|
|
|
|
block.cpp is the only C++ file in libdispatch and doesn't call the static
|
|
inline functions from lock.h. These functions fail to compile in C++ mode
|
|
because stdatomic.h was only standardized for C++ in C++23. Before C++23,
|
|
stdatomic.h doesn't provide memory_order_* constants. We use GCC's libstdc++
|
|
which only provides C11 atomics in C++23 mode, not in C++11 mode.
|
|
|
|
Wrap all static inline functions in #ifndef __cplusplus so they are not
|
|
compiled when lock.h is included from C++ files, while keeping the type
|
|
definitions available.
